The charts show the population of some of the world's largest cities and the world population. Summarise the information given and make comparisons where relevant.

The two charts illustrate the populace of megacities and the global population in millions and billions respectively. The first chart is for the year 1990 and 2030, while the second chart depicts the population of the world from the year 1980 to the year 2030 for village and city areas.

The bar chart displays that in the year 1990 Tokyo had around 16 million citizens, New York had around 14 million and Shanghai came in third at around 12 million. However, it is projected by the year 2030 Bombay and Jakarta will have inhabitants of around 26 million and around 19 million respectively.

In the line chart, it was observed that in the year 1980 around 2.9 billion were residing in rural areas which will grow to around 3.2 billion by the year 2030. On the other hand urban cities had the number of 1.5 billion in 1980 and is predicted to rise to around 5 billion by the year 2030.

In conclusion population in megacities will grow by 2030 while, there will be a rise in the population of urban residents by the year 2030.
